What exactly is an electronic marketplace? Essentially, it is an online platform that connects buyers and sellers, enabling them to transact business without the need for physical interaction. These marketplaces can be general in nature, like Amazon, where you can find almost anything you need, or specialized, like Etsy, where independent creators sell handmade goods and vintage items.
One of the key advantages of electronic marketplaces is the convenience they offer. With just a few clicks, consumers can browse through a vast array of products and services, compare prices, read reviews, and make purchases without ever leaving their homes. This convenience has been a game changer for many people, especially those with busy schedules or limited access to brick-and-mortar stores.
For businesses, electronic marketplaces provide a platform to reach a wider audience and increase sales. Small businesses and independent sellers, in particular, have benefited greatly from these platforms, as they can now compete with larger companies on a level playing field. electronic marketplaces also offer tools and resources to help businesses manage their operations, such as inventory management, order processing, and payment processing.
In addition to convenience and accessibility, electronic marketplaces also offer a sense of security and trust for both buyers and sellers. Most platforms have built-in safeguards to protect against fraud and ensure that transactions are secure. Buyers can read reviews and ratings from other customers before making a purchase, while sellers can establish their credibility through their online profiles and ratings.
The success of electronic marketplaces can be attributed to several factors. One of the key drivers is the rise of mobile technology, which has made it easier for people to shop online anytime, anywhere. The proliferation of smartphones and tablets has made it possible for consumers to access electronic marketplaces on the go, leading to a rise in mobile commerce.
Another factor is the increasing globalization of the economy. electronic marketplaces have made it easier for businesses to reach international markets and sell their products to customers around the world. This has led to a boom in cross-border e-commerce, with companies of all sizes expanding their reach beyond their domestic markets.
Furthermore, electronic marketplaces have democratized entrepreneurship, allowing anyone with an internet connection to start their own business and reach a global audience. Platforms like Shopify, eBay, and Etsy have made it possible for individuals to turn their hobbies and creative pursuits into profitable ventures, without the need for a physical storefront or significant investment.
Despite the many benefits of electronic marketplaces, there are also challenges and concerns that need to be addressed. One of the major issues is the problem of counterfeit and pirated goods, which can undermine trust in the marketplace and harm legitimate businesses. Platforms need to implement robust measures to combat counterfeiting and piracy, such as authentication processes and intellectual property protections.
Another challenge is the issue of data privacy and security. electronic marketplaces collect a vast amount of data on their users, including personal information and browsing habits. It is essential for platforms to protect this data and comply with regulations such as the General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R) to ensure the privacy and security of their users.
